we had same issue a few weeks ago with one of our 20+ lists - look at headers of the 2nd+ duplicate message you get and see if it details the email address it's trying to send to -
in our case, I placed my self on the list, customer sent out posting, and I got the intitial mail, then also got 4 add'l copies of it each time. All add'l copies had an X-RCPT to another address from the list, all the same address; As soon as I deleted this address from list, the problem cleared up. The bad address on list was ironically on another IMail server with another ISP - The only thing I can figure (I'm no techie) is that for whatever reason, the mail to this address was never seen as accepted or rejected by our server, so the list on our server just kept trying to deliver until it timed out.
